Output 3d17ebc23f306d20e45afd7ff5e25deaa90da060cde456590aaa7c8d9c889648:0

value
4036303678
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77113aefed7620178779fd900e8dcb5d706e6f86d226fe5cc89634bcedec3d42
address
tb1pwugn4mldwcsp0pmelkgqarwtt4cxumux6gn0uhxgjc6tem0v84pq0tws83
transaction
3d17ebc23f306d20e45afd7ff5e25deaa90da060cde456590aaa7c8d9c889648
confirmations
33393
spent
true